Residential Natural Gas Rates in Maumelle

Residential natural gas prices in Maumelle, AR (based on Arkansas data) averaged $12.28 per thousand cubic feet in January 2024. This average rate was approximately 3.9% more than the U.S. average rate of $11.82 per thousand cubic feet for residential customers in the most recent month with data. [1]

Year over year, the average residential natural gas rate in Maumelle decreased 33.01 percent, from $18.33 per thousand cubic feet in January 2023 to $12.28 per thousand cubic feet in January 2024. [1]

Industrial Natural Gas Rates in Maumelle

Maumelle, AR industrial natural gas prices in January 2024 (based on Arkansas data) averaged $9.51 per thousand cubic feet, which was approximately 91.7% more than the average rate of $4.96 per thousand cubic feet in the United States overall in the most recent month with data. [1]

Year over year, the average industrial natural gas rate in Maumelle decreased 25.06 percent, from $12.69 per thousand cubic feet in January 2023 to $9.51 per thousand cubic feet in January 2024. [1]

Maumelle Natural Gas Customers

Maumelle Natural Gas Customers

An estimated 566,288 residential consumers use natural gas in Arkansas, which is approximately 0.8% of the total number of residential natural gas consumers in the United States overall. [2]

Maumelle: There are an estimated 3,333 residential natural gas customers in the city of Maumelle. [3]


Residential Natural Gas Consumption in Maumelle

Natural Gas Usage in Maumelle

Residential natural gas usage in Arkansas in January 2024 was 6,884 million cubic feet, or approximately 0.7% of the total residential consumption in the U.S. of 918,996 million cubic feet that month. [1]

Maumelle residents used an estimated 41 million cubic feet of natural gas in January 2024, or about 1 percent of the overall usage in Arkansas that month. [3]
